Armenian Genocide Commemoration April 24
Each spring, on the 24th of April, numerous Armenians from Armenia and all corners of the world, come to Armenia and organize a united march to the Tsitsernakaberd Genocide Memorial. In this way they commemorate the victims of the Armenian Genocide by the Ottoman Empire, which resulted in one and a half million deaths.
This year, on the 23th of April, we will again commemorate the Armenian Genocide Day. On this day thousands of people will walk from Matendaran with torches in their hands to Tsitsernakaberd Genocide Memorial. Next day, early in the morning, the president of the Republic of Armenia and many other politicians will come to Tsitsernakaberd to show their tribute to the victims of the Genocide. Millions of Armenians will come to Tsitsernakaberd to lay flowers at the eternal flame.
